First thing you have to do is match lighting with the plants you want. Also the deeper the tank the more light you need to reach the plants. Easiest plants are java fern, which comes in many variation, and hornwort.
In place of co2 flourish excel by seachem and dry supplements can be used. Have found main important ferts are potassium sulfate and iron. The plants need a lot of potassium and iron helps the plants, which are red, stay red.
For test kits need at least test for ph, ammonia, and nitrates. Sometimes on EBay you find a multi- test kit for a good price.
For the winter you need a heater. I bought new ones on EBay.
A filter is debateable. Some whom have plants don't have filter. I just have 1 sponge filter.
